##
## The following variables can be customized at build time. Use env or export to change at your wish
##
##   Example: env _microarchitecture=99 use_numa=n use_tracers=n use_pds=n makepkg -sc
##
## Look inside 'choose-gcc-optimization.sh' to choose your microarchitecture
## Valid numbers between: 0 to 99
## Default is: 0 => generic
## Good option if your package is for one machine: 99 => native
if [ -z ${_microarchitecture+x} ]; then
  _microarchitecture=0
fi

## Disable NUMA since most users do not have multiple processors. Breaks CUDA/NvEnc.
## Archlinux and Xanmod enable it by default.
## Set variable "use_numa" to: n to disable (possibly increase performance)
##                             y to enable  (stock default)
if [ -z ${use_numa+x} ]; then
  use_numa=y
fi

## For performance you can disable FUNCTION_TRACER/GRAPH_TRACER. Limits debugging and analyzing of the kernel.
## Stock Archlinux and Xanmod have this enabled. 
## Set variable "use_tracers" to: n to disable (possibly increase performance)
##                                y to enable  (stock default)
if [ -z ${use_tracers+x} ]; then
  use_tracers=y
fi

## Enable PDS CPU scheduler by default https://gitlab.com/alfredchen/linux-pds
## Set variable "use_pds" to: n to disable (stock Xanmod)
##                            y to enable
if [ -z ${use_pds+x} ]; then
  use_pds=n
fi

# Compile ONLY used modules to VASTLYreduce the number of modules built
# and the build time.
#
# To keep track of which modules are needed for your specific system/hardware,
# give module_db script a try: https://aur.archlinux.org/packages/modprobed-db
# This PKGBUILD read the database kept if it exists
#
# More at this wiki page ---> https://wiki.archlinux.org/index.php/Modprobed-db
if [ -z ${_localmodcfg} ]; then
  _localmodcfg=n
fi

prepare() {
  cd linux-${_major}

  # Apply Xanmod patch
  patch -Np1 -i ../patch-${pkgver}-xanmod${xanmod}

  msg2 "Setting version..."
  scripts/setlocalversion --save-scmversion
  echo "-$pkgrel" > localversion.10-pkgrel
  echo "${pkgbase#linux}" > localversion.20-pkgname

  # Archlinux patches
  local src
  for src in "${source[@]}"; do
    src="${src%%::*}"
    src="${src##*/}"
    [[ $src = *.patch ]] || continue
    msg2 "Applying patch $src..."
    patch -Np1 < "../$src"
  done

  # CONFIG_STACK_VALIDATION gives better stack traces. Also is enabled in all official kernel packages by Archlinux team
  scripts/config --enable CONFIG_STACK_VALIDATION

  # Enable IKCONFIG following Arch's philosophy
  scripts/config --enable CONFIG_IKCONFIG \
                 --enable CONFIG_IKCONFIG_PROC

  # User set. See at the top of this file
  if [ "$use_tracers" = "n" ]; then
    msg2 "Disabling FUNCTION_TRACER/GRAPH_TRACER..."
    scripts/config --disable CONFIG_FUNCTION_TRACER \
                   --disable CONFIG_STACK_TRACER
  fi

  if [ "$use_numa" = "n" ]; then
    msg2 "Disabling NUMA..."
    scripts/config --disable CONFIG_NUMA
  fi

  if [ "$use_pds" = "y" ]; then
    msg2 "Enabling PDS CPU scheduler by default..."
    scripts/config --enable CONFIG_SCHED_PDS
  fi

  # Let's user choose microarchitecture optimization in GCC
  sh ${srcdir}/choose-gcc-optimization.sh $_microarchitecture

  # This is intended for the people that want to build this package with their own config
  # Put the file "myconfig" at the package folder (this will take preference) or "${XDG_CONFIG_HOME}/linux-xanmod/myconfig"
  # If we detect partial file with scripts/config commands, we execute as a script
  # If not, it's a full config, will be replaced
  for _myconfig in "${startdir}/myconfig" "${XDG_CONFIG_HOME}/linux-xanmod/myconfig" ; do
    if [ -f "${_myconfig}" ]; then
      if grep -q 'scripts/config' "${_myconfig}"; then
        # myconfig is a partial file. Executing as a script
        msg2 "Applying myconfig..."
        bash -x "${_myconfig}"
      else
        # myconfig is a full config file. Replacing default .config
        msg2 "Using user CUSTOM config..."
        cp -f "${_myconfig}" .config
      fi
      echo
    fi
  done

  make olddefconfig

  ### Optionally load needed modules for the make localmodconfig
  # See https://aur.archlinux.org/packages/modprobed-db
  if [ "$_localmodcfg" = "y" ]; then
    if [ -f $HOME/.config/modprobed.db ]; then
      msg2 "Running Steven Rostedt's make localmodconfig now"
      make LSMOD=$HOME/.config/modprobed.db localmodconfig
    else
      msg2 "No modprobed.db data found"
      exit
    fi
  fi

  make -s kernelrelease > version
  msg2 "Prepared %s version %s" "$pkgbase" "$(<version)"

  [[ -z "$_makenconfig" ]] || make nconfig

  # save configuration for later reuse
  cat .config > "${startdir}/config.last"
}

_package-headers() {
  pkgdesc="Header files and scripts for building modules for Xanmod Linux kernel"

  cd linux-${_major}
  local builddir="$pkgdir/usr/lib/modules/$(<version)/build"

  msg2 "Installing build files..."
  install -Dt "$builddir" -m644 .config Makefile Module.symvers System.map \
    localversion.* version vmlinux
  install -Dt "$builddir/kernel" -m644 kernel/Makefile
  install -Dt "$builddir/arch/x86" -m644 arch/x86/Makefile
  cp -t "$builddir" -a scripts

  # add objtool for external module building and enabled VALIDATION_STACK option
  install -Dt "$builddir/tools/objtool" tools/objtool/objtool

  # add xfs and shmem for aufs building
  mkdir -p "$builddir"/{fs/xfs,mm}

  msg2 "Installing headers..."
  cp -t "$builddir" -a include
  cp -t "$builddir/arch/x86" -a arch/x86/include
  install -Dt "$builddir/arch/x86/kernel" -m644 arch/x86/kernel/asm-offsets.s

  install -Dt "$builddir/drivers/md" -m644 drivers/md/*.h
  install -Dt "$builddir/net/mac80211" -m644 net/mac80211/*.h

  # http://bugs.archlinux.org/task/13146
  install -Dt "$builddir/drivers/media/i2c" -m644 drivers/media/i2c/msp3400-driver.h

  # http://bugs.archlinux.org/task/20402
  install -Dt "$builddir/drivers/media/usb/dvb-usb" -m644 drivers/media/usb/dvb-usb/*.h
  install -Dt "$builddir/drivers/media/dvb-frontends" -m644 drivers/media/dvb-frontends/*.h
  install -Dt "$builddir/drivers/media/tuners" -m644 drivers/media/tuners/*.h

  msg2 "Installing KConfig files..."
  find . -name 'Kconfig*' -exec install -Dm644 {} "$builddir/{}" \;

  msg2 "Removing unneeded architectures..."
  local arch
  for arch in "$builddir"/arch/*/; do
    [[ $arch = */x86/ ]] && continue
    echo "Removing $(basename "$arch")"
    rm -r "$arch"
  done

  msg2 "Removing documentation..."
  rm -r "$builddir/Documentation"

  msg2 "Removing broken symlinks..."
  find -L "$builddir" -type l -printf 'Removing %P\n' -delete

  msg2 "Removing loose objects..."
  find "$builddir" -type f -name '*.o' -printf 'Removing %P\n' -delete

  msg2 "Stripping build tools..."
  local file
  while read -rd '' file; do
    case "$(file -bi "$file")" in
      application/x-sharedlib\;*)      # Libraries (.so)
        strip -v $STRIP_SHARED "$file" ;;
      application/x-archive\;*)        # Libraries (.a)
        strip -v $STRIP_STATIC "$file" ;;
      application/x-executable\;*)     # Binaries
        strip -v $STRIP_BINARIES "$file" ;;
      application/x-pie-executable\;*) # Relocatable binaries
        strip -v $STRIP_SHARED "$file" ;;
    esac
  done < <(find "$builddir" -type f -perm -u+x ! -name vmlinux -print0)

  msg2 "Adding symlink..."
  mkdir -p "$pkgdir/usr/src"
  ln -sr "$builddir" "$pkgdir/usr/src/$pkgbase"

  msg2 "Fixing permissions..."
  chmod -Rc u=rwX,go=rX "$pkgdir"
}
